CLARK Earns Distinction of Best Places to Work in Kentucky 2023

Lexington, KY – March 15, 2023 The Kentucky Chamber of Commerce and the Kentucky Society for Human Resource Management (KYSHRM) have designated CLARK Material Handling Company—a top-ten manufacturer of forklifts and spare parts with headquarters in Lexington, Kentucky—as one of the Best Places to Work in Kentucky for 2023!

 

This marks the fifth time CLARK has earned the prestigious employee-driven Best Places to Work award. Previously, CLARK earned this distinction in 2013, 2019, 2020, and 2022.

 

This distinction is bestowed on both CLARK Kentucky facilities: their American Headquarters and manufacturing plant in Lexington, and their state-of-the-art parts distribution center in Louisville. 

Each year, the KYSHRM and the Kentucky Chamber of Commerce determine the top 30 companies in each size category (small, medium, and large) through employee surveys, as well as through review of the company’s benefits, policies, practices, and demographics. CLARK employees respond to questions about the culture, employee engagement, wellness program benefits, and more to determine whether the company earns the distinction of being one of the Best Places to Work in Kentucky.

This statewide program, created in 2004, identifies, recognizes and honors the best places of employment in Kentucky.  The Best Places to Work in Kentucky Initiative is based on FORTUNE Magazine’s “100 Best companies to work for in America” list.

About CLARK Material Handling Company


CLARK Material Handling Company has been an industry leader since its production of the first gasoline powered material handling truck in 1917. CLARK has over 550 locations worldwide with dealer representation in more than 80 countries. A full range of I.C. and Electric trucks for diverse applications are available in the CLARK product line.
